पुलाव
A seasoned rice dish cooked in broth with vegetables, meat, or spices. It is a common and versatile meal in Indian cuisine, ranging from simple home-cooked versions to elaborate festive varieties.

اغلب اشتباه گرفته میشود با
Pulao is generally cooked together with all ingredients in one pot and is less spicy, whereas Biryani involves layering half-cooked rice and meat/veg.
Khichdi is a soft, mushy mixture of rice and lentils, while Pulao features separate, fluffy grains of rice.
نکات کاربردی
The word 'पुलाव' is a masculine noun. It is often used with the verb 'बनाना' (to make) or 'पकाना' (to cook).
اشتباهات رایج
Learners often treat 'pulao' as plural because it contains many grains of rice, but in Hindi, it is treated as a singular mass noun.

ریشه کلمه
Derived from the Persian word 'pulaw' and related to the Sanskrit word 'pulāka' (a ball of rice).

بافت فرهنگی
Pulao is a staple at Indian weddings and Sunday lunches, often paired with yogurt-based 'Raita'.
